A9VG电玩部落论坛

 找回密码
 注册
搜索
查看: 24647|回复: 30

【G世纪World】帮你替换BGM,你只需要识别曲目(我不认得高达音乐)

[复制链接]

精华
0
帖子
282
威望
0 点
积分
-6 点
种子
0 点
注册时间
2010-12-2
最后登录
2015-3-4
 楼主| 发表于 2011-3-2 05:19  ·  加拿大 | 显示全部楼层 |阅读模式
本帖最后由 purer9 于 2011-3-2 12:30 编辑

大家好
经过一些研究,我已成功的把开始界面的歌曲换成了 岛谷瞳-深红。
我的希望是把不给力的BGM通通换掉,可是我不识得G世纪World中的许多歌曲。
一些明显的我知道,但多半还是不认得。

iso中音频文件的排列顺序好像与游戏中欣赏模式的顺序不同
如果大家愿意帮忙,我可以上传所有的BGM对应它们在 iso 中的文件名。
你们只需要告诉我哪一首属于哪一部高达,然后给我一些替换对象的建议。
比如说你发现 FILE000001.wav 属于cca 那我就可以换成Beyond the Time等等。

实在没人帮忙的话我也可以一首一首的听,然后对应游戏中来辨别。
但就算我知道某首歌对应某部高达,我还是不知道换成什么比较好。

本人觉得 G世纪World 作为一款 PSP 游戏实在很不错,就音乐方面有点遗憾。
若能弥补这一点,我很乐意。但我在改游戏背景音乐这方面确实没有半点经验。
假若有人对换BGM感兴趣的话请在此留言。

-----------------------------------------------------------
具体替换方法:

替换BGM我用了5个工具
-sony媒体注射器
-Wave Splitter
-DBK studio
-adxencd
-千千静听

http://forum.tgbus.com/viewthread.php?tid=1928576&extra=&page=1
上面的Bus链接有提供下载

运行注射器
文件类型选择adx
浏览到G世纪的iso
点击导出
iso附近应该会出现一个放满adx文件的文件夹
里面有个LBA文本,需要保留
把adx文件从大到小排列
除了最大的200多个以外其他的应该可以删掉
用千千静听把你喜欢的mp3转成wav(在列表中右键选转换格式)
采样频率要和对应的adx文件一样,好像是 **50Hz
adx文件的频率可以在安装 DZK studio 后直接播放查看
运行 DZK studio,点 工具->批量音频转换器,把对应的adx文件转成wav格式
用 Wave Splitter 打开从adx转来的wav文件,注意 "End at:" 后面的数字
再用 Wave Splitter 打开从mp3转来的wav文件
在 "End at:" 后面的空格内输入之前看到的那个数字
然后点 带剪刀图样的 "Go"字
如果形成的文件大于原wav文件,你可以尝试把那个数字大幅度减少
直到形成的文件小于或等于原wav文件 (右键查看精确大小)
点屏幕左下角的 START
运行那个DOS样的东西
输入 "cd.." 然后回车
重复次步骤直到你看到 C:\
把adxencd.exe和之前剪好的wav文件放在C盘下的一个新建文件夹,比如说BGM
(文件夹要事先建好)
回到那个DOS样的东西
输入:
adxencd.exe name.wav -lps000 -lpeXXXX
"name"是之前那个剪好了的wav文件的名字
"xxxx"是一个关于重播时间的数字
到底该写什么我也不知道
根据我的经验, 大约**00一秒
假如原 BGM 为 1分46秒, wav文件叫 1.wav 的话
(60+46)x**00=2332000
你就该输入 :

"adxencd.exe 1.wav -lps000 -lpe2332000"

把产生的adx文件重命名得跟原adx文件一样
在iso旁边新建一个文件夹 "@xxx.iso"
xxx 是iso的名字
把原先的 LBA.txt文本和刚刚产生的adx文件放入
该文件夹内
运行注射器, 选择iso路径, 选择adx, 然后注入就可以了




精华
0
帖子
2550
威望
0 点
积分
2653 点
种子
0 点
注册时间
2009-7-1
最后登录
2014-5-22
发表于 2011-3-2 08:07  ·  上海 | 显示全部楼层
替换BGM要注意一点就是你替换的文件要≤原文件,不然看似没问题,到时候肯定哪里要出错的,除非重新打包ISO。但是如果ISO过大的话也要出问题。
该用户已被禁言

精华
0
帖子
109
威望
0 点
积分
124 点
种子
0 点
注册时间
2005-12-26
最后登录
2020-1-4
发表于 2011-3-2 09:04  ·  广东 | 显示全部楼层
回复 purer9 的帖子

楼主能否教教我你是如何替换? 是否已找到方法解包和封包CPK文件? 我试了很多方法都无效,请帮忙!!!

精华
0
帖子
702
威望
0 点
积分
717 点
种子
5 点
注册时间
2007-11-24
最后登录
2014-7-31
发表于 2011-3-2 10:02  ·  江苏 | 显示全部楼层
同求bgm替换方法,这次的bgm确实不行啊,wars里面很多好的怎么删掉了呢

精华
0
帖子
134
威望
0 点
积分
160 点
种子
1 点
注册时间
2005-9-18
最后登录
2024-12-18
发表于 2011-3-2 10:39  ·  香港 | 显示全部楼层
將WARS裏超一擊時的主題曲換入就完美了

精华
0
帖子
282
威望
0 点
积分
-6 点
种子
0 点
注册时间
2010-12-2
最后登录
2015-3-4
 楼主| 发表于 2011-3-2 10:46  ·  加拿大 | 显示全部楼层
本帖最后由 purer9 于 2011-3-2 10:50 编辑
春日结乃 发表于 2011-3-2 08:07
替换BGM要注意一点就是你替换的文件要≤原文件,不然看似没问题,到时候肯定哪里要出错的,除非重新打包ISO ...


是啊,很麻烦
我以前也没做过这种事的经验。
替换的文件要是>原文件时程序根本不让我换
我试了很久才成功
现在貌似可以在游戏中重播,
但以后有没有问题我也不知道
主要是暂时没有高手愿意麻烦自己,
所以想要听音乐的我只能动手自己弄。。。
该用户已被禁言

精华
0
帖子
2222
威望
0 点
积分
2083 点
种子
19 点
注册时间
2007-12-5
最后登录
2024-8-25
发表于 2011-3-2 10:51  ·  天津 | 显示全部楼层
本帖最后由 c.azrael 于 2011-3-2 11:04 编辑

我真是没有想到PSP版会用低码率的ADX而没用ATRAC3plus,这样牺牲很大容量,效果还未必好
cri的封包工具打出来的包兼容性未知 以前试过一些游戏 如果大量替换的话 有的没问题 但是有的会死机
另外做好loop也不容易,LZ+U吧

精华
0
帖子
282
威望
0 点
积分
-6 点
种子
0 点
注册时间
2010-12-2
最后登录
2015-3-4
 楼主| 发表于 2011-3-2 10:59  ·  加拿大 | 显示全部楼层
本帖最后由 purer9 于 2011-3-2 11:01 编辑
yugiohcard 发表于 2011-3-2 09:04
回复 purer9 的帖子

楼主能否教教我你是如何替换? 是否已找到方法解包和封包CPK文件? 我试了很多方法都无效 ...


我是跟着Bus上的一个教程做的。
自己一边做一边总结方法。
当时我总结的方法是随手用英文写的,过一会儿我再来用中文写一遍

等不及的可以先看这儿:
http://forum.tgbus.com/viewthread.php?tid=1928576&extra=&page=1

use 注射器.exe to extract adx files.
Sort them to know which one is useful.

Use 千千静听 to convert mp3 to wav file.
Be sure to match the whatever rate (Hz) the file
has. You can see the Hz rate by opening the adx file
in DBK studio.

Use wave splitter to split the wave file to the matcing
number. You can check the original extracted file's number
by also using wave splitter.

You can convert the extracted adx files to wav using DBK studio.

Downsize the new wav file to match the old one by splitting
more.

Drag adxencd.exe into the same folder as your new wav file.
It is best if you put the folder containing the wav file under
c:\ or D:\ directly. Say let's name it BGM.

Open command prompt.
Type "cd.." until you get to D:\
type "cd BGM"
type "adxencd.exe name.wav -lps000 -lpexxxx"

name is whatever name your wav file has.
for xxxx 45 seconds is about 1000000
so **00(tested to work) per seconds.

rename the newly formed adx file to the matching adx file name.

make a folder called @name.iso
name is the name of your iso.
put the "LBA.txt" extracted before into @name.iso
put your new adx file in that folder too.

Use 注射器.exe, choose your iso, choose adx and 导入
该用户已被禁言

精华
1
帖子
350
威望
1 点
积分
371 点
种子
0 点
注册时间
2005-1-4
最后登录
2022-11-15
发表于 2011-3-2 11:24  ·  广西 | 显示全部楼层
支持楼主,把替换教程写出来吧,其实用PC的WILL模拟器玩才爽啊,不知道可不可以一样替换
该用户已被禁言

精华
0
帖子
35
威望
0 点
积分
35 点
种子
0 点
注册时间
2006-7-9
最后登录
2020-1-6
发表于 2011-3-2 12:10  ·  上海 | 显示全部楼层
支持楼主,期待教程,英文的看不懂,额
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|A9VG电玩部落 川公网安备 51019002005286号

GMT+8, 2024-12-22 10:12 , Processed in 0.210415 second(s), 17 queries ,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

返回顶部